Analyzing Key Lines in Dont Stop Believing Lyrics
The opening lines set the scene vividly:
Just a small-town girl
Livin’ in a lonely world
She took the midnight train goin’ anywhere
These words evoke a sense of adventure mixed with uncertainty. The “small-town girl” symbolizes anyone stepping out of their comfort zone, willing to embrace the unknown. Similarly, the “midnight train” suggests a journey that is both literal and metaphorical—a leap toward new opportunities.
Another memorable segment is:
Strangers waiting
Up and down the boulevard
Their shadows searching in the night
Here, the imagery of strangers and shadows captures the loneliness and anonymity that often accompany the pursuit of dreams. Yet, the shared experience of waiting and searching connects these individuals, emphasizing a communal hope.
The iconic chorus:
Don’t stop believin’
Hold on to that feelin’
Streetlights, people
This chorus is the emotional heart of the song. It’s not just a catchy hook but a powerful reminder to cling to positivity and belief. The “streetlights, people” phrase grounds the message in the everyday, highlighting that hope exists amidst ordinary life.

Exploring the Songwriting and Composition of Dont Stop Believing Lyrics
Understanding the songwriting process behind the lyrics adds another layer of appreciation. Written by Journey members Steve Perry, Jonathan Cain, and Neal Schon, the song was crafted to be both relatable and uplifting.
Jonathan Cain famously contributed the piano riff that opens the song, setting a tone that is instantly recognizable. The lyrics were designed to tell a story that listeners could project themselves into, making the song feel personal and universal simultaneously.

Understanding the Context of Dont Stop Believing Lyrics
"Don’t Stop Believin’," released in 1981 on Journey’s album Escape, became one of the band’s most iconic songs. Written by Steve Perry, Jonathan Cain, and Neal Schon, the track combines a powerful melody with lyrics that evoke a narrative of hope amidst adversity. The lyrics themselves tell the story of everyday people — a small-town girl and a city boy — navigating life's uncertainties and holding on to their dreams.

Hope Against Adversity
One of the most compelling aspects of the lyrics is how they balance realism with optimism. The song acknowledges loneliness and uncertainty — "living in a lonely world" — but counters this with an insistence on persistence. This duality reflects a mature understanding of life’s complexities, making the song neither naïvely optimistic nor cynically dismissive.
